Property NewsMay 21, 2009 Yellowcake Mining Inc. announced that, effective May 15, 2009, it terminated its lease and option agreements relating to the Uravan-Beck properties, dated December 28, 2007. The property is host to a number of past-producing uranium-vanadium mines located in western Colorado, USA. September 15, 2008 An extensive data base for the Return Mine has been acquired. This data includes over 200 drill holes, mine designs for an expanded mine, and economic models for the proposed mine. Drill permits are in the process of being acquired and the intent is to drill this summer and fall. This drilling will examine possible
mineralization at selected other known areas of unmined potential mineralization. July 21, 2008 The necessary permits to allow drilling were received. The permits are for ten sites of known uranium-vanadium mineralization which will be tested by air-rotary drilling and gamma logging.
